Glass Material, Composite Board, Others in the Global Modular Ballistic Partition System Market:
In the Global Modular Ballistic Partition System Market, materials play a crucial role in determining the effectiveness and efficiency of the partitions. Among the most commonly used materials are glass, composite boards, and other specialized materials. Glass, in this context, is not the ordinary glass used in windows but rather a specially treated ballistic glass designed to withstand high-velocity impacts. This type of glass is often laminated and layered to enhance its strength and durability, making it capable of stopping bullets and other projectiles. The use of ballistic glass in modular partitions is particularly advantageous in environments where visibility is essential, such as control rooms or observation posts, as it allows personnel to maintain a clear line of sight while remaining protected. Composite boards, on the other hand, are engineered materials made from a combination of different substances to achieve superior strength and resilience. These boards are lightweight yet incredibly strong, making them ideal for use in modular partitions that need to be both portable and robust. The composite materials often include layers of aramid fibers, ceramics, and other high-performance materials that work together to absorb and dissipate the energy from ballistic impacts. This makes composite boards a popular choice for applications where weight is a critical factor, such as in mobile units or temporary installations. In addition to glass and composite boards, the market also utilizes a variety of other materials, each selected for its specific properties and advantages. These can include metals like steel and aluminum, which offer excellent protection and durability, as well as advanced polymers and ceramics that provide a balance of strength and weight. The choice of material often depends on the specific requirements of the application, such as the level of threat, the need for mobility, and the environmental conditions. For instance, in areas with high humidity or extreme temperatures, materials that are resistant to corrosion and thermal expansion may be preferred. Global Modular Ballistic Partition System Market Outlook:
The outlook for the Global Modular Ballistic Partition System Market indicates a promising trajectory, with significant growth anticipated over the coming years. In 2024, the market was valued at approximately US$ 616 million, reflecting the increasing demand for advanced security solutions across various sectors. By 2031, the market is projected to expand to a revised size of US$ 798 million, driven by a compound annual growth rate (CAGR) of 4.3% during the forecast period.
